    Have a settings to opt out of ContentSuggestions · f55c6b19
    gambard authored
    The user needs to be able to opt out of Content Suggestions if needed.
    Android is coupling the Omnibox suggestions and the Content suggestions
    setting but it is probably clearer to have it separated.
    However the names are misleading and need to be changed.
    
    TEST= Toggle the switch Settings->Privacy->"Show Content Suggestions".
    - When enabled the suggestions are shown as expected.
    - When disabled, the remote suggestions("Articles for You") currently
      displayed are removed.
      When opening a new NTP the Articles for You section is empty.
    The Reading List section is unaffected.
